Healthy Sautéed Vegetables

  • Total Time: 15 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Diet: Vegan

Description

This healthy sautéed vegetables recipe is a quick, colorful, and nutrient-rich side dish perfect for any meal or dietary plan!


Ingredients

Scale

1 tbsp olive oil or avocado oil

1/2 yellow onion, sliced

1 cup broccoli florets

1 red bell pepper, sliced

1 yellow bell pepper, sliced

1 cup baby carrots, halved lengthwise

1 cup mushrooms, sliced

2 cups spinach or kale

2 cloves garlic, minced

Salt & black pepper to taste

Optional: red chili flakes, lemon juice, or balsamic glaze


Instructions

1. Heat oil in a skillet over medium-high heat.

2. Add onions, carrots, and broccoli. Sauté for 4–5 minutes.

3. Stir in peppers, mushrooms, and garlic. Cook for 3–4 minutes.

4. Add greens and sauté until wilted.

5. Season with salt, pepper, and optional toppings.

Notes

Cut vegetables evenly for consistent cooking.

Avoid crowding the pan — cook in batches if needed.

Add acidic toppings like lemon or vinegar to brighten flavor.
